Generally speaking, sweating after fever is conducive to cooling, but children, especially the younger children, because the heat dissipation mechanism is not fully developed, the skin can not cool well through sweating during fever, so many babies will not sweat during fever. In this case, we need to choose the appropriate cooling method according to the degree of fever and the physical condition of the baby. 2. Wipe the baby's whole body with warm water or take a bubble bath, which can speed up metabolism, expand pores, or take off two clothes for the baby to dissipate heat; 3. If necessary, let your baby take antipyretic drugs or go to the hospital, such as water, pastille, suppository or injection can quickly reduce your baby's fever.
